✦ Synopsis


The equihbrium between monomericand associated forms of pertIuorocarboxylic acids in carbon tetrachloride solution has been studied by Fourier transform infrared spectrometry. It was found that the overlap of the carbonyl stretching bands of the monomer and associated forms was too great to permit the nature of the associated form to be determined accurately. After conversion of the solvent-compensated absorbance spectra to their second derivative and measurement of the height of the secondary maxima of the overlapping bands, the associated species was confirmed to be the dimer.
